Rino is painfully aware of this shift. She knows she is being neglected. She knows she is unhappy. Yet, the crux of the manga—and its title—lies in her refusal to leave. The phrase "Soredemo Ashita mo Kareshi ga ii" translates roughly to "Even so, I still want him to be my boyfriend tomorrow." It is a declaration of stubborn, irrational love that prioritizes the status of "being his girlfriend" over her own emotional well-being.

At its core, the story of "Soredemo Ashita mo Kareshi ga Ii" begins with a seemingly perfect, lovey-dovey couple: and Mako . They are deeply in love, and their relationship is full of affection. However, a significant shadow looms over them: Mako has been consistently refusing to have sex with Kouhei. Despite their strong bond, this lack of physical intimacy leaves Kouhei worried and frustrated.
